About the Book

Hurricane Andrew was an historic event for Miami, Florida that occurred in late August 1992. This story is based on experiences of those who sufferred through it. Some were courageous and honorable. Others sought only personal gain. The subject of this story is the conflict between these two extremes over the restoration of a seriously damaged residence. The conflict goes on at the site, in financial institutions, county government and the courthouse. A related sub-plot involves a hotel which housed many of those who came to take part in the restoration.


About the Author

After graduating from the University of California in 1941, with a major in chemistry, the author served as a flight instructor and Patrol Plane Commander in the Navy and a research chemist with a major chemical company. His duties included writing reports and editing those of his staff. Fifty years ago he left the chemical company to work as a marketing consultant, project development engineer, insurance consultant and real estate broker-salesman during the ensuing years. He now lives in an apartment complex near his son in the high desert country of the Southwest.
